What we'll unpack

Property investors are navigating a very different finance environment from lending policy and borrowing structures to changing serviceability and borrowing capacity.

Godfrey will sit down with Justin and Eddie to explore both sides of the equation: how investors can think about financing their next move, and how those decisions translate into evaluating a real opportunity.

Some of the questions we'll explore

  • What's changing across the finance and lending market for property investors?
  • How are recent policy and budget changes affecting investors?
  • What should investors understand about buying through companies and trusts?
  • How can investors think about scaling borrowing capacity as their portfolio grows?
  • What makes a property opportunity genuinely compelling beyond the headline numbers?
  • How do experienced investors assess the risks, trade-offs and upside of a real deal?
